The Lexus IS (XE20) is the second generation of the Lexus IS line of compact executive cars….
| Lexus IS (XE20) | |
|---|---|
| Class | Compact executive car (D) Mid-size sports sedan (IS F) |
| Body style | 4-door sedan 2-door coupé convertible |
| Layout | Front-engine, rear-wheel drive Front-engine, all-wheel drive |
| Platform | Toyota N platform |
Is Lexus IS 250 front or rear wheel drive?
Available in either rear-wheel or all-wheel drive configurations, the IS 250 is powered by a 204 horsepower 2.5-liter V6. The rear-wheel drive IS 250 utilizes a standard six-speed manual transmission, while a six-speed automatic with Formula 1 inspired paddle-shifters available as an option.

What are the specs of a Lexus IS-F?
1 Powertrain Engine: 5.0 Liter V8 Estimated Horsepower: More than 400 Estimated Torque: More than 350 lb.-ft. 2 Brakes Large diameter cross-drilled discs Front/Rear: 14.2 inches/13.6 inches Opposed aluminum calipers Front/Rear: Six piston/two piston 3 Wheels Forged aluminum wheels Front: 225/40R19 (19 x8) Rear: 255/35R19 (19 x 9)
Where did the new Lexus IS F come from?
Much of the development of the new IS-F took place at Fuji Speedway and the Higashi-Fuji Technical Center in Japan. The IS-F is based on the proven rear-wheel-drive Lexus IS, which is equipped with a double-wishbone front and multi-link rear suspension. As well as the IS performs, Lexus engineers demanded much more of the all-new IS-F.

What kind of car is the Lexus IS?
The current “entry level” model for the Lexus sedan line, the IS consists of the IS 250 in rear-drive or all-wheel-drive variations and the more potent rear-drive IS 350 — as well as a new-for-2008 high-performance version, the IS-F (reviewed separately).
What kind of AWD does a Lexus IS 350 have?
The IS 250 AWD adds a sophisticated all-wheel drive system and an automatic transmission as standard equipment, while the 306-horsepower IS 350 is available with the automatic only and has the Vehicle Dynamic Integrated Management (VDIM) package and upgraded, larger brakes.
